Premium Protein for Optimal Growth
The foundation of any superior small cat diet is a source of high-quality animal protein that is easy for the body to process. This focus on digestibility ensures that the essential amino acids needed for muscle development are readily absorbed, supporting the active nature of smaller breeds.

By prioritizing named meat meals and fresh poultry, these formulas provide a concentrated source of nutrition without excessive fillers. This approach helps maintain a lean physique while supplying the raw materials necessary for strong growth and development in young animals.
Enhanced Nutrient Absorption

Specific advantage small cat ingredients are selected to improve the bioavailability of key vitamins and minerals. This means the nutrients from the food are absorbed more efficiently, reducing waste and ensuring the cat gets the maximum benefit from each meal.
For example, chelated minerals bind to amino acids, making them easier for the small digestive system to utilize. This strategic inclusion addresses common sensitivities and supports overall systemic health, from skin condition to immune response.
Balanced Fats for Energy

Healthy fats play a critical role in providing a dense source of energy that small cats need to thrive. Ingredients like chicken fat and fish oil not only taste appealing but also deliver essential fatty acids that contribute to a glossy coat and optimal brain function.
The precise balance of om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ids helps manage inflammation and supports cardiovascular health. This careful calibration of fats ensures sustained energy throughout the day, matching the playful antics of a lively kitten or adult cat.

Prebiotic and Probiotic Elements
To foster a healthy gut microbiome, many advanced recipes incorporate prebiotic fibers and probiotic cultures. These elements work together to nourish beneficial bacteria, which is essential for proper digestion and nutrient extraction.
A thriving gut environment contributes to better stool quality and reduces occurrences of diarrhea or constipation. This internal balance is a key indicator that the chosen ingredients are supporting the cat's system effectively.
Antioxidant-Rich Additions
Antioxidants are crucial for combating oxidative stress and supporting cellular health, particularly in active or aging small cats. Ingredients such as blueberries, cranberries, and Vitamin E are commonly added for their protective properties.
These compounds help neutralize free radicals, which can damage cells over time. By including a variety of antioxidant sources, the food helps promote longevity and a robust immune system, allowing the cat to remain energetic and playful.
